In the fast-paced world of entrepreneurship and career, stress and burnout can
take a toll on women. It’s essential to prioritize self-care and adopt strategies to
manage stress effectively.
In this blog post, we will explore some helpful tips on how to thrive under
pressure.
1. Set Clear Boundaries
Establishing boundaries is crucial to maintain a healthy work-life balance. Learn
to say no when necessary and prioritize self-care. For instance, set aside
dedicated time for herself every day, whether it's for exercise, hobbies, or simply
relaxation. This practice will help you recharge and stay resilient in the face of
stress.
2. Practice Mindfulness
Incorporating mindfulness techniques into your daily routine can significantly
reduce stress levels. Take moments to pause, breathe, and be present. You
could practice mindfulness through meditation and journaling. These practices
will help you stay focused, calm, and better equipped to handle stressful
situations.
3. Delegate and Seek Support
Don’t be afraid to delegate tasks and seek support when needed. Surround
yourself with a reliable team or network of individuals who can share the
workload. It’s important to understand the importance of delegation and build a
supportive team that helps you manage your workload effectively, reducing
stress and avoiding burnout.
4. Prioritize Self-Care
Self-care is not a luxury; it’s a necessity. Make time for activities that bring you
joy and relaxation. Whether it’s engaging in hobbies, spending time with loved
ones, or practicing self-care rituals, like taking a bubble bath or reading a book,
prioritize self-care.
Managing stress and avoiding burnout is essential for women in
entrepreneurship and career. By setting clear boundaries, practicing mindfulness,
delegating tasks, and prioritizing self-care, you can maintain your well-being and
thrive in your professional journey. Remember, your well-being is just as
important as your work.
